Staff certification tracker template
Log your team's certifications and expiry dates in-browser. The status column, days-remaining chip and 30/60/90 day rollup update as you type so lapses are visible at a glance.
Who this is for and what it solves
- Site managers and ops leads tracking crew cards and tickets
- HR and compliance teams monitoring training expiry across a team
- Small trades running CSCS and first aid renewals themselves
Manual staff trackers rot the moment nobody looks at them. This gives you a live colour-coded status column and a next-90-days view while you type so a lapsed CSCS card cannot hide in a spreadsheet.

How it works
- Step 1Add a row per person
Name, role, certification and expiry. Use a preset certification or type your own.
- Step 2See the status update live
Current, expiring within 30 days, expired or missing a date. Days-remaining chip on every row.
- Step 3Download the CSV
Sorted by soonest expiry, ready for Excel or Google Sheets. Or track it live in Credbase.
